[0028] Embodiments of the present invention provide a method for reporting uplink traffic, an intermediate node, and a channel switching method and system. The purpose of the channel switching method and system is to use the E-DCH to carry uplink data services, and the UE will include uplink traffic The scheduling information of the information is reported to the NODEB, and the NODEB reports the uplink traffic to the RNC through dedicated measurement or expansion of the data frame of the E-DCH frame protocol (FP, Frame Protocol), and the RNC judges whether the uplink traffic satisfies channel switching Judgment conditions, which can avoid the situation that the NODEB fails to report the uplink traffic of the E-DCH to the RNC and cannot switch or adjust the bandwidth of the E-DCH channel. Abstract

The invention discloses a report uplink service quantity method, a middle node and channel switch method and a system; wherein, the channel switch method comprises that when the uplink service is established in a reinforced uplink special channel E-DCH, an uplink service quantity information is reported to a wireless network controller by a special measurement type or the uplink service quantity information is reported to the wireless network controller in an extension E-DCH channel data frame type, and the wireless network controller switches the E-DCH channel according to the uplink service quantity information. The invention can achieve the switch and bandwidth adjustment to the E-DCH channel according to the uplink service quantity information when the uplink service of the wireless network controller is established on the E-DCH channel, thus saving cell resource; furthermore, the invention can avoid channel error switch or bandwidth error adjustment caused by unknown service quantity, thus improving the stability of the service which is carried on the E-DCH channel.

technical field [0001] The invention relates to the field of wireless communication, in particular to a method for reporting uplink business volume, an intermediate node, a channel switching method and a system. Background technique [0002] For Wide-band Code Division Multiple Access (WCDMA) systems based on Release 99 or Release 4 standards, the uplink and downlink capacity of bearing services is relatively limited, theoretically no more than 2 Mbps. Moreover, the actual throughput rate of a single user is relatively low, and the maximum allowed transmission rate is usually 384Kbps. The actual transmission rate often cannot reach such a high rate, which is obviously insufficient for services that provide high-speed data services.
